The Enigma of the Vanishing Gold

In the heart of the ancient Chinese countryside, there lay a castle shrouded in legend and mystery. Known only to the few who dared to seek its secrets, the castle was said to be the resting place of a vast treasure of gold, hidden away for centuries. This was the tale of a young adventurer named Ming, whose life was forever changed by the enigma of the vanishing gold.

Ming had always been a dreamer, with a heart full of tales of chivalry and romance. One evening, as he sat by the campfire with his best friend, Li, the subject of the vanishing castle was brought up. Li, a jaded warrior, laughed and dismissed the story as mere fantasy, but Ming's eyes sparkled with a fire that could not be extinguished.

"It's more than a tale, Li," Ming declared, his voice filled with conviction. "It's a quest for love and adventure. I must find the vanishing castle and claim its gold for my true love."

Li, intrigued by Ming's fervor, agreed to accompany him on the perilous journey. Together, they set out on a quest that would take them through treacherous forests, over treacherous mountains, and across treacherous rivers. The path was fraught with challenges, but Ming's heart was steadfast, driven by the promise of love and the allure of the gold.

As they ventured deeper into the unknown, Ming and Li encountered the first of many tests. A riddle from an ancient scroll was placed before them, and only those with a pure heart could decipher its meaning. Ming, with a deep breath, solved the riddle, revealing a hidden path that led them to a cavernous chamber deep within the earth.

The cavern was a labyrinth of mirrors, each reflecting a different image of Ming and Li. The path forward was unclear, and they were forced to rely on their wits and the trust they had built. Ming, the truest of hearts, was able to navigate the maze with ease, while Li, though he struggled, found himself grateful for Ming's guidance.

Emerging from the mirrors, they found themselves at the heart of the castle. The grand hall was adorned with gold and jewels, but it was the pedestal at the center that caught their attention. Upon it lay a chest, glowing with an otherworldly light. It was the treasure of the vanishing castle, and its power was as mysterious as its origins.

As they approached the chest, Ming felt a surge of emotion. He knew that this gold was not just a symbol of wealth, but a symbol of their love. He reached out to open it, but before he could, a voice echoed through the hall, "Who seeks the treasure of the vanishing castle?"

Ming and Li turned to see an ancient guardian, a figure of stone and shadow, standing before them. The guardian spoke again, "The treasure you seek is not of gold, but of love. Only those who prove their love in the face of adversity may claim it."

The guardian then presented them with a test. They were to leave the castle and return with a love token from their true love, something that would prove their affection. Ming and Li accepted the challenge and set out into the world.

Back in the village, Ming sought out his true love, a young woman named Hua, whose eyes held the same sparkle as his own. He confessed his love, and with tears in her eyes, Hua agreed to meet him at the edge of the forest. Ming, with a heart full of hope, set off to retrieve the love token.

As he approached Hua, he found himself face-to-face with Li, who had been following him. Li revealed that he too loved Hua, and that he had been watching Ming's every move. The two men came to an agreement, deciding to split the treasure and share the love of Hua.

With the love token in hand, Ming and Li returned to the castle. The guardian nodded in approval and allowed them to open the chest. Instead of gold, they found a single, radiant golden feather. The guardian explained that this was the true treasure, a symbol of the love they had shared and the strength it had given them.

Ming and Li left the castle, their hearts full of joy and their lives forever changed. They returned to the village, where Hua awaited them with open arms. Ming and Hua were united in love, and Li, though he did not win Hua's heart, found solace in the friendship of Ming.

The vanishing castle, with its enigmatic treasure, had not only brought Ming and Hua together but had also shown the true value of love and friendship. And so, the legend of the vanishing gold lived on, a tale of romance, adventure, and the enduring power of the human heart.
